Position: Warehouse Associate - Multiple shifts

As an Order Fulfillment Processor, you will play an important part of the team by assisting in picking, packing, auditing, ticketing, and tagging. You'll be working with products from some awesome clients that are heavily involved in the active lifestyle.

What does success look like in this role?

Success in this role can be defined by being reliable, accurate and efficient. A quick learner, who is able to balance quality, pace and efficiency with safety being the cornerstone. Being cognizant of the impact of your role on others and removing obstacles for the next person in line. Treat others with kindness and respect and show up each day ready to give it your all.

All About You What You'll Bring to the Role:
  • No previous warehouse experience is required but it is always a plus!
  • Ability to learn our basic warehouse management scanning system (WMS)
  • Strong attention to detail and time management skills
  • Has the ability to be flexible and adapt to changing priorities
  • Trustworthy and moral character
The Must Haves:
  • Must have physical ability to carry out essential job functions, including but not limited to the ability to lift and carry up to 50 lbs, walking and standing for extended periods, are okay with heights in elevated areas, climbing ladders/stairs, comfortable with dust, dirt, noise, odors, heat, cold, etc.
Things You Will be Doing
  • Picking, packing, scanning, tagging, returns, replenishment along with other general warehouse duties
  • Following NRI safety rules, safety procedures, security protocol and standard operating procedures (SOP)
  • Keeps work and storage areas in a safe, clean, and tidy condition at all times.
